Solution Overview
Problem
Existing healthcare systems face challenges in efficiently managing medication adherence, particularly with multiple medications, and lack seamless communication channels for real-time monitoring and intervention.
Innovation Solution
A conversational interface application using AI/ML to assess medication adherence, provide reminders, and suggest interventions, capable of handling multiple medications and switching communication channels based on patient preference.
Engineering Contradictions & Design Principles
Engineering Contradiction Analysis
1Reliability
If manual medication review is performed during patient visits, then medication adherence can be monitored, but it requires significant provider time and creates a cumbersome process
Solution Approach 1:
The system performs medication review and adherence monitoring before the patient arrives at the clinic. The automated phone system contacts patients prior to their visit, retrieves medication information, and completes the review process in advance, eliminating the need for providers to spend time on this task during the appointment.
Solution Approach 2:
Patients actively participate in the medication review process by providing their medication information during automated phone calls. The system enables patients to self-report their medications, dosages, and adherence status, reducing the burden on providers while maintaining comprehensive monitoring.
2Adaptability or versatility
If multiple communication channels are used for patient interactions, then patient engagement can be improved, but channel integration is lost and users must exit and choose new channels
Solution Approach 1:
The system consolidates multiple communication channels (phone, email, portal) into a single integrated platform. The automated phone system can initiate conversations, transfer calls to providers, send reminders, and coordinate care all through one unified interface, eliminating the need for patients to switch between different systems.
Solution Approach 2:
The communication system is designed to perform multiple functions through a single channel. The same phone interface can be used for medication reviews, appointment scheduling, provider consultations, and care coordination, making the system versatile and reducing patient burden.
3Reliability
If medication review is performed during facility visits, then comprehensive review can be conducted, but patients may forget medication names or previous suggestions
Solution Approach 1:
The system retrieves and presents medication information to patients before their visit through automated phone calls. This preliminary review ensures patients have their medication lists ready and can accurately recall their regimens, eliminating reliance on patient memory during the clinic appointment.
Solution Approach 2:
The automated phone system provides feedback to patients about their medication adherence status and compares it against their prescribed regimen. This continuous feedback loop helps patients remember their medications and identifies potential issues before they arise.
